Internet Explorer 11.0.11 2014 Full Free Download Offline Installer | IE 11 Offline Installer waled b Browsers 28 August 2014 Internet Explorer 11 (IE11) is a version of Internet Explorer , a web browser, by Microsoft. It was officially released on 17 October 2013 ... Read more